Browse Source

new: gyp

git-svn-id: http://trac.vinelinux.org/repos/projects/specs@1138 ec354946-7b23-47d6-9f5a-488ba84defc7
iwaim 14 years ago
parent
commit
a21bf3d22d
1 changed files with 51 additions and 0 deletions
  1. 51 0
      g/gyp/gyp-vl.spec

+ 51 - 0
g/gyp/gyp-vl.spec

@@ -0,0 +1,51 @@
+%define	ver	0.1
+%define	rel	1
+%define	svnrev	827
+
+Summary: Generate Your Projects
+Name: gyp
+Version: %{ver}
+Release: %{rel}.svn%{svnrev}
+License: New BSD License
+Group: Development/Tools
+URL: http://code.google.com/p/gyp/
+# svn checkout http://gyp.googlecode.com/svn/trunk gyp
+Source0: %{name}-%{version}-r%{svnrev}.tar.bz2
+Patch0: gyp-0.1-r827-shebang.patch
+B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-buildroot
+BuildArch: noarch
+BuildRequires: python-devel
+Requires: python
+
+Vendor: Project Vine
+Distribution: Vine Linux
+Packager: iwaim
+
+%description
+Generate Your Projects
+
+%prep
+%setup -q -n %{name}-%{version}-r%{svnrev}
+%patch0 -p 1
+
+%build
+%{__python} setup.py build
+
+%install
+%{__rm} -rf %{buildroot}
+%{__python} setup.py install --root %{buildroot}
+
+%clean
+%{__rm} -rf %{buildroot}
+
+%files
+%defattr(-,root,root,-)
+%doc LICENSE AUTHORS samples tools
+%{_bindir}/gyp
+%{python_sitelib}/gyp-*.egg-info
+%{python_sitelib}/gyp
+
+%changelog
+* Fri Jun  4 2010 IWAI, Masaharu <iwai@alib.jp> 0.1-1.svn827
+- Initial build.
+